FINAL: La Salle 2, VCU 1 (Richmond, Va. – Sports Backers Stadium)

HOW IT HAPPENED:
- Each team had a pair of shots on goal in the first 15 minutes of the match. Junior Courtney Conrad had two long strikes for VCU (7-4-3, 2-2-0 A-10) but La Salle goalkeeper Gabrielle Pakhtigian made stops on both attempts.
- Sophomore Cristin Granados created a chance in the 16th minute when she sent a cross to the middle of the box. Sophomore Maren Johansen got her head on the ball but it sailed just wide of the near post.
- Conrad fired a point blank strike again from the left side of the goal box seven minutes later but Pakhtigian came up with her third save of the day.
- VCU eventually took a 1-0 lead in the 48th minute when senior Heather Hovanesian sent a pass from the right wing to senior Wendy Acosta in front of the goal box. Acosta turned and slid a shot past Pakhtigian to the far post to put the Rams ahead.
- La Salle (10-3-0, 4-0-0) had a look seven minutes later off a corner kick but Courtney Niemiec's shot from outside the box drifted high.
- VCU created another chance in the 59th minute when junior Brianne Moore sent a pass to Acosta on the left wing. Acosta then crossed to Conrad in front of the net but her one-timer went just high of the crossbar.
- Senior goalkeeper Kristin Carden made a nice snag near the far post on a shot from Kelsey Haycook in the 62nd minute. She came up with another stop off a free kick from Maryam Huseini four minutes later.
- Renee Washington launched a long shot from about 25 yards out in the 73rd minute but Carden made her fifth save of the match to keep the Explorers off the board.
- La Salle eventually scored the equalizer in the 77th minute. Carden came up with a save on a shot by Jessika Kagan but Ashley Chilcoat punched in the rebound to knot the game at 1-1.
- Anna Dolhansky then took a long feed from Huseini and placed a perfect ball in the far post from the right wing to give the Explorers a 2-1 lead five minutes later.
- After a Granados cross with just over a minute to play in regulation, Hovanesian sent a header toward the net but Pakhtigian made a snag to keep the Explorers on top.
- Conrad then launched a shot from 25 yards out as time expired but couldn't find the net.
BEYOND THE BOX SCORE:
- VCU suffered its first home loss since Aug. 28, 2011, which was a stretch of 11 straight matches.
- Acosta scored a goal for the third straight game and fourth in her last five outings.
- Conrad fired a game-high five shots (two on goal), while seven different players collected a shot for the Rams.
- Carden finished with seven saves in the net.
